McDonald’s will train all its restaurant staff after widespread sexual harassment allegations

McDonald’s is requiring anti-harassment training across all 39,000 of its restaurants, the company said Wednesday. Kimberly Godwin is about to be the first Black person to run a major US broadcast network newsroom

Kimberly Godwin is about to make history — as the incoming president of ABC News, she’ll be the first Black executive to run one of America’s major broadcast network newsrooms. Dollar General will hire 20,000 workers

Dollar General plans to hire 20,000 workers this spring as the discount chain continues its expansion during the pandemic. The company said Wednesday it’s looking to hire full- and part-time workers in stores and distribution centers, as well as drivers for its private-trucking fleet.
